Output 427a21327260807cbaa7ef2526119f0245786470d26de595466f81542ef0f60f:0

value
450000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9662d7f7cbc02c612b3605c1930b6772d2628fb6 OP_EQUAL
address
3FQBh6Ph8xNWQchB4YwE6XEQCRs6X5DbpL
transaction
427a21327260807cbaa7ef2526119f0245786470d26de595466f81542ef0f60f
spent
true